Little Symphonies – We Used To Be Immortal (LP)
Little Symphonies’ debut LP We Used To Be Immortal is an emotionally heavy, atmospheric record. Written by Maxim Ventulé and Tom Gudde over two and a half years, the album is a deeply personal exploration of grief and mortality, framed around the loss of Ventulé's mother and his childhood home in Vlissingen, Netherlands.
The record balances profound sadness with eventual hope and processing. Musically, it eschews typical minimalism for a sweeping, grand sonic landscape that critics and listeners liken to an indie-symphonic rock hybrid. The atmospherics amplify the deeply personal songwriting, making it a cathartic, introspective listen from start to finish
